In this episode, Dr. Kahn kicks off with some motivating insights from recent research showing that climbing stairs can lower death rates. He then explores two new studies highlighting the benefits of creatine and roasted green tea (hojicha) for brain performance. Find creatine here: Dr. Joel Kahn's Creatine Capsules.
Dr. Kahn also delves into the roles of growth hormone (GH) and insulin-like growth factor 1 (IGF-1) in health and disease, focusing on Laron Syndrome. This rare condition involves life-long low levels of IGF-1, leading to shorter stature but also lower rates of diabetes, cancer, and heart disease.
